A variety of reading materials are collected and listed here for your use in order to improve your reading skills in Japanese. Each article is prepared in three different formats: original text; text with furigana; and text with Japanese-English dictionary (Click on the picture below to see an example screen shot).

How to Install Japanese Characters

You need Japanese fonts in your system in order to view Japanese characters (Hiragana, Katakana and Kanji) properly. You can download the Japanese fonts from the following sites.

Windows XP users
Global IME with Japanese Language Pack or Far East Language Pack might be on the System CD-ROM.
If it is not on the disk, please download Global IME from Microsoft web site.
(Select Global IME with Japanese Language Pack or Far East Language Pack)
MAC OS X (ten) users
Japanese Fonts are already on the System CD-ROM
